87 Bridle Close, Enfield, EN3 6EB is a freehold terraced property built between 1967-1975. The property offers approximately 904 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£363,284 , which equates to approximately £402 per square foot. It was last sold on 21 Oct 2016 for £313,000. Since then, the value has increased by £50,284, representing a 16.1% increase, or approximately 1.8% per year.

The current estimated value of £363,284 is:

  • 49.8% higher than the average property price on Bridle Close
  • 41.9% higher than the average in the EN3 6EB postcode area
  • and 26.5% lower than the average price for Enfield as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 5 September 2016,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

87 Bridle Close, Enfield, Greater London Authority, EN3 6EB has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 5 Sep 2016.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.
